❓ Which redirect is best for SEO Migrations? ❓ 

When it comes to redirects in migrations, not all are created equal.

👉 301 Redirect (Permanent)
 ✅ Passes SEO equity
 ✅ Best for migrations, URL changes, domain switches
 ✅ Tells Google the move is permanent

👉 302 Redirect (Temporary)
 ⚠️ Does not consistently pass SEO value
 ⚠️ Tells Google the redirect is short-term
 ⚠️ Can cause confusion if left in place long-term

👉 307 Redirect (Temporary, HTTP/1.1)
 Similar to a 302, but more technical and rarely used for SEO purposes

If you’re doing a website migration or changing URL structures, the best choice is almost always a 301 redirect. It’s the signal Google trusts to transfer authority and preserve your rankings.
